Ukraine expresses its full solidarity with Great Britain regarding its conclusions about Russia's use of chemical weapons in Salisbury and Amesbury.

"The conclusions of the Organization for the Prohibition of Chemical Weapons that the toxic chemicals used in the Amesbury and Salisbury attacks are of the same nature is another confirmation of the Russian Federation's continuing aggressive policy aimed against the states' sovereignty and undermining international law and order," the Ministry of Foreign Affairs of Ukraine said in a statement.

It is reported Ukraine reiterates its firm stance that the use of chemical weapons by anyone, anywhere and under any circumstances is a flagrant violation of international law and those responsible for such actions must be held accountable.

"We are convinced that only international solidarity may be an effective response to the constant provocations of the Russian Federation, and we encourage our foreign partners to continue coordinated pressure on the Kremlin to make it refuse from its aggressive actions," reads the statement.
